一、外卖系统“卡脖子”时,三招教你破局!
1. 流量整形:给汹涌订单装上“缓冲阀”
当校园午间订餐洪峰袭来,系统崩溃往往始于无序的请求冲击。借鉴电商**策略,在网关层部署令牌桶算法,使每秒万级请求被平滑处理为可控的吞吐量。某高校实践显示,通过动态令牌发放机制(如热门餐厅自动降速至500单/秒),配合用户端排队动画提示,不仅将API错误率从32%降至1.2%,更巧妙利用心理学效应提升用户容忍度。这层“漏斗”设计如同给爆水管加装减压阀,让后续系统获得喘息空间。
2. 弹性伸缩:让服务器学会“呼吸式扩容”
传统固定集群在订单低谷期闲置60%资源,高峰时却捉襟见肘。引入K8s+HPA自动扩缩容方案后,系统能像肺泡般动态伸缩:根据RocketMQ堆积消息数实时调整Pod数量,午高峰容器组从50激增至300,下午茶时段自动回缩。某平台实测显示,结合阿里云ECI秒级容器启动技术,扩容耗时从5分钟压缩到22秒,资源成本反降41%。关键在于设定多维度指标(CPU/并发数/消息延迟)加权公式,避免单一指标误触发。
3. 服务治理:给数据库穿上“防爆甲”
高并发下*脆弱的数据库环节,需布防多重保险。某外卖平台通过三级防御实现百万QPS:首先用Redis集群承接90%查询请求(如商家菜单缓存);再以数据库连接池+线程池限制(如HikariCP*大连接数控制);*后对MySQL实施读写分离+分库分表(按校区划片)。当检测到订单表响应超时500ms时,自动触发降级策略,将新订单暂存Kafka队列,待压力缓解后补偿入库,避免雪崩式崩溃。
4. 数据策略:用“空间换时间”破译性能密码
在日均百万订单系统中,1秒的查询优化可提升27%吞吐量。某高校研发的“预计算引擎”每日凌晨将热门菜品数据(销量/评分/库存)生成物化视图,使午高峰查询从8表关联简化为单表扫描。更创新的是利用GIS空间索引技术:将校区地图划分为500m×500m网格,骑手位置更新时只触发周边网格索引重建,使路径规划耗时从3.2s降至0.4s。这种用存储冗余换取计算效率的策略,本质是重构时空关系的关键破局点。
预约免费试用外卖配送平台系统: https://www.0xiao.com/apply/u9071533
二、校园外卖大考:"抢课级"洪峰下的架构突围战
1. 洪峰挑战:校园外卖的特殊性
校园场景的流量洪峰具备高度集中性、时段可预测性与延迟敏感性三大特征。午餐时段订单量可在5分钟内暴增20倍,远超普通电商场景的波动幅度。不同于社会外卖,校园用户集中在宿舍区、教学楼等特定区域,导致API调用呈现地理热点聚集现象。更关键的是,学生群体对400毫秒以上的响应延迟容忍度极低,这要求系统必须在维持低延迟的前提下承载突发流量。传统固定资源池架构在如此剧烈的脉冲冲击下,往往在扩容完成前就已崩溃。
2. 弹性架构设计:三级缓冲体系
构建前端引流层、应用服务层、数据存储层的三级弹性缓冲机制是破局关键。在前端采用边缘节点流量整形,通过动态令牌桶算法将超过阈值的请求直接返回友好提示页,避免流量穿透。应用层部署无状态容器化服务,结合K8s HPA实现基于订单并发数的秒级扩缩容,实测可在90秒内完成300个Pod的横向扩展。数据库层采用读写分离+缓存爆破防护,通过Redis分片集群承接瞬时查询,配合MySQL线程池动态调节技术,将数据库吞吐瓶颈点推高3倍。该架构在某211高校实战中成功承载了单分钟1.2万订单的冲击。
3. 资源调度策略:从"救火"到"预判"
突破被动式扩容的关键在于建立智能预测模型。通过分析历史订单数据,识别出校园场景特有的流量规律:课程表变更引发的用餐时间偏移、体育课后订单激增、考试周夜宵需求爆发等特征事件。构建LSTM神经网络模型,结合天气数据、校园日程表等多维因子,实现未来2小时流量预测准确率达85%。基于此实施分时段预扩容策略,在预测洪峰前30分钟自动完成70%资源预热,剩余30%资源由实时监控触发。该方案使资源利用率提升40%,同时避免过度扩容造成的成本浪费。
4. 成本与效能平衡术
弹性扩容必须直面成本约束。采用混合云部署模式,将基线负载部署在物理机保障性价比,突发流量由公有云承接。创新性实施"分时切片"策略:将10:3013:00的高峰期细分为15分钟级时间窗,根据不同窗口的预测流量配置差异化的弹性阈值。开发冷热资源池管理技术,对容器镜像实施分级存储,使新节点启动时间从45秒压缩至12秒。通过上述措施,某平台在吞吐量提升3倍的同时,将月度云成本增幅控制在15%以内。
5. 容灾设计:当扩容遇上天花板
必须建立扩容失效的兜底方案。设计分级降级机制:在CPU负载超过90%时自动关闭推荐引擎等非核心服务;当数据库压力突破阈值时,启用本地内存缓存替代实时查询;在极端情况下启动"订单快照"模式,将订单信息暂存至消息队列,待峰值回落后再异步处理。建立跨可用区熔断策略,当单区域资源枯竭时,自动将流量引导至备用区域。某平台在2023年"双十一"校园活动中,通过该机制在云资源售罄的情况下仍保障了核心下单功能可用。
预约免费试用外卖配送平台系统: https://www.0xiao.com/apply/u9071533
三、指尖上的“校园春运”:当外卖拥堵遇上技术破壁
1. 拥堵的真相:高峰期的“数字踩踏事件”
校园外卖高峰期堪比春运抢票现场。午间12点整,数万学生同时点击手机屏幕引发的瞬时流量洪峰,使服务器每秒承受着近3万次请求冲击。数据库在订单提交、库存校验、骑手分配的多重压力下,响应时间从200毫秒飙升至8秒,支付成功率断崖式下跌至65%。这种技术层面的“踩踏事件”,暴露了传统单体架构在弹性扩容上的致命缺陷——如同十车道高速突遇百万车流,再宽的通道也会瘫痪。
2. 技术破壁三板斧:从堵点到通途
首斧劈向流量调度:通过动态限流算法,系统在检测到瞬时峰值时自动开启“潮汐车道”。将非核心功能(如商家推荐)请求延迟处理,确保订单支付等关键路径资源独占。次斧重构数据库:分库分表技术将200GB的订单数据拆分到32个数据库节点,结合读写分离策略,使查询耗时降低87%。第三斧落在智能容灾:当某区域配送站异常,系统自动启动“细胞分裂”模式,由邻近站点接管订单并重新规划路径,故障恢复时间从20分钟压缩至40秒。
3. 体验重构:流畅背后的蝴蝶效应
性能优化触发的体验升级呈链式反应。支付成功率达98%后,用户放弃率下降带来订单密度提升,这使得智能调度系统能更**地合并相邻订单。某高校实测数据显示,骑手单次配送量提升40%,学生等餐时间平均缩短15分钟。更值得关注的是心理体验的转变:进度条实时预估、异常订单秒级赔付等功能,将不确定性焦虑转化为确定性期待,用户满意度指数逆势增长22个百分点。
4. 技术温度:从工具理性到价值理性
本次优化超越纯技术维度,揭示了数字化服务的本质逻辑。当系统在暴雨天自动延长商家接单时间,在考试周动态放宽配送时限,技术开始展现人文关怀。某平台在毕业季推出的“记忆订单”功能,通过性能优化释放的算力资源,为离校生生成四年点餐轨迹图谱。这种从解决卡顿到创造惊喜的跃迁,标志着性能优化正从工具理性升维至价值理性,重新定义着校园服务的温度刻度。
预约免费试用外卖配送平台系统: https://www.0xiao.com/apply/u9071533
总结
成都零点信息技术有限公司成立于2012年,是一家集软硬件设计、研发、销售于一体的科技型企业,专注于移动互联网领域,完全拥有自主知识产权【35件软件著作权、15个商标、3个版权和1个发明专利】。作为知名互联网产品研发公司,一直秉承着“诚信、热情、严谨、**、创新、奋斗”的企业精神,为高校后勤、餐饮零售老板及大学生创业者提供成套数字化运营解决方案,助力其互联网项目成功。我们坚持聚焦战略,持续投入研发,用前沿的技术提升客户行业竞争力。公司备受社会关注,曾受多家电视台采访报道,荣获国家高新技术企业等荣誉。

零点校园40+工具应用【申请试用】可免费体验: https://www.0xiao.com/apply/u9071533
小哥哥